The BFC/Vogue Fashion Fund 2021 Nominees and Winner

Bethany Williams Wins the 2021 BFC/Vogue Designer Fashion Award

Launched in 2008, the British Fashion Council and Vogue Designer Fashion Fund is dedicated to supporting the next generation of exceptional talent in fashion, design, and business savvy. This year, the BFCVDFF nominated 11 trailblazing designers, of whom Bethany Williams was chosen to receive a £200,000 cash prize, in addition to mentoring from some of the brightest minds in the fashion industry.

"Congratulations to Bethany Williams for receiving the BFC/Vogue Designer Fashion Fund for 2021," said British Vogue editor-in-chief and chair of the fund committee Edward Enninful in a press statement. "Bethany is an extraordinary talent who brings a depth to her process that is nothing short of inspirational. On top of her substantial gifts as a designer, she has rethought the way her collections are made, working with women who are homeless or in prison, among others, using her business to bring training and support. She really is a marvel."

Along with 2021 winner Bethany Williams, fellow nominees for the BFC/Vogue Designer Fashion Fund were Alighieri, ASAI, Chopova Lowena, Completedworks, E.L.V. Denim, Halpern, Kwaidan Editions, Olubiyi Thomas, Richard Malone, and Supriya Lele.

Previous winners of the BFC/Vogue Designer Fashion Fund are Wales Bonner (2019), Molly Goddard (2018), Mother of Pearl and Palmer//Harding (2017), Sophia Webster (2016), Mary Katrantzou (2015), Peter Pilotto (2014), Nicholas Kirkwood (2013), Jonathan Saunders (2012), Christopher Kane (2011), and Erdem (2010). For 2021, the £200,000 cash prize is being generously supported by Burberry, Paul Smith, British Vogue, and Clearpay.
